You want to ensure that you remove all the liquid when you finish so you don’t make a bigger stain. 6. Steel Wool with Lemon or Olive Oil. Web27 jan. 2024 · 3. Toothpaste and Baking Soda. Some people have found success with toothpaste and baking soda. Mix the two ingredients together, rub thoroughly into the stain, sit for a few minutes, and then wipe dry. The baking soda is alkaline and tough on stains, while the toothpaste allows it to penetrate the wood better. 4.

Web14 feb. 2024 · 1. Mix together a thick paste of baking soda and water. If you're dealing with a burn on a dark wood surface, the burn itself is most likely white in color. To remove the burn mark, combine about 1 tsp (0.3 g) of baking soda and 1⁄8 teaspoon (0.62 mL) of water in a small bowl. Web20 apr. 2024 · To remove the deposits, you can use a baking soda paste or a vinegar and water solution. Here are the steps to prepare a baking soda paste: Make a paste of baking soda and water in amounts that’ll match the size of the white spot. Apply the mixture to the spot with a small brush or cloth, then let sit for 10 minutes.

Web25 okt. 2024 · First, clean the affected area with a moist towel and allow it to dry. Prepare a mixture of toothpaste and baking soda. Gently rub the stain-removing paste into the stain using a clean cloth. Allow the paste to work for 5-15 minutes on the spot. Clean the leftovers away using a wet towel.
